Who is behind Imprimo?

Imprimo is the collective effort of organizations with an established record in the visual artist and rightsholder communities: The Canadian Artists’ Representation / Le front des artistes Canadiens (CARFAC), Copyright Visual Arts / Droits d’auteur Arts visuels (COVA-DAAV) and Regroupement des artistes en arts visuels du Quebec (RAAV).

It has been built by Prescient, the innovation lab of Access Copyright, with funding from the Canada Council for the Arts.

Can I sell my art on Imprimo?

Imprimo is not an e-commerce platform today. It’s an artwork management tool that can help you make connections that lead to sales, and to receive fair compensation for any use or reproduction of your work. Our work-history timeline and certificates of creation demonstrate a trusted connection between art and artist that enables galleries and buyers to acquire with confidence and you to expand opportunities for your work.

So: we help you build connections and to demonstrate authenticity and value, but we don’t facilitate sales.

Should you plan to sell your art on another platform, you can link to your Imprimo profile there so prospective buyers have access to Imprimo’s trusted information about your work’s history and creation.

Certificates of Creation and Blockchain
How does Imprimo use blockchain?

Imprimo uses blockchain technology to create publicly verifiable certificates that permanently connect an artist to their work.

When you create a Certificate of Creation in Imprimo, this event is registered by time stamping a decentralized blockchain ledger.

It’s a digital fingerprint – unique to each connection between an artist and their work.

What is a Certificate of Creation? What information does it contain? What can I do with it?

Many artists use certificates of authenticity as a physical receipt and a form of risk prevention. Certificates enable people interested in your work to approach it with confidence that you are the creator and the knowledge of when and where the work was created.

Imprimo’s Certificates of Creation contain information such as title, artist, dimensions, media type and the date and place of creation to offer assurance and security when an art buyer is purchasing a piece or a curator is planning an exhibition.

Certificates also include a blockchain ID: an incorruptible link between the artwork and the artist’s claim of ownership.

Our Certificates of Creation are issued with a QR code that links to the artwork record on Imprimo. Click “Download Certificate” from the administration page of any artwork to download as a pdf.
